전체 글 (41) 썸네일형 리스트형 저작권 무료 아이콘 사이트 Remix Icon 웹 퍼블을 하면서 수많은 아이콘과 이미지들을 정리하고 다루는 건 정말 귀찮은 일인 것 같습니다... 정리하는 걸 잘 못하는 저에게 있어서 아이콘과 이미지를 일일히 네이밍하고 분류하여 정리하는 건 javascript를 공부하는 것 보다 더 고역입니다. 그런 저에게 있어서 Remix Icon 사이트는 구세주나 다름없답니다! https://remixicon.com/ Remix Icon 사이트의 아이콘들은 모두 저작권 무료이므로 걱정없이 사용하셔도 됩니다. 해당 글에 따르면 자유롭게 사용해도 괜찮고 본인 프로젝트에 "Remix Icon"을 언급해주면 매우 고맙겠지만 필수는 아닙니다. 다만, 아이콘들을 판매해서는 안됩니다. 라고 적혀있습니다. 천사같은 분들이네요 > [DAY 01] 홀수, 짝수 판별하기 - %로 나머지값 보기 문제 숫자를 매개 변수로 전달받아 짝수인지 홀수인지 판별하는 함수를 isODD 라는 이름으로 작성하고, 이 함수를 호출해 실행한 결과를 HTML 문서에 표시하세요 정수가 2로 나눠서 0이 나오면 : 짝수 정수가 2로 나눠서 1이 나오면 : 홀수 휴대폰 번호 입력 형식 - replace() 와 substring 휴대폰 입력 형식 1) 숫자 사이 '-' 자동기입 '-' 자동 기입은 되나 3자리 까지 입력시 '-''-' 두 개가 동시에 나옴 '-' 바는 000-0000-0000 처럼 순차적으로 나와야함 2) 글자 입력 불가 숫자입력 후 글자는 입력이 불가 최초 입력시 글자 기입이 가능 (tel의 pattern으로 인한 알람이 뜨기 때문에 큰 요소는 아님) 추후 코드 업그레이드가 필요 return 에 대한 js 초보의 야매정리 javascript를 공부하게 된 이후로 "return" 이란 개념은 너무나 이해하기 어려운 개념이었다. 그래서 내식대로 정리를 해봤다. 제대로 된 사용을 모르는 초보자의 정리이므로 괜히 따라 이해했다가 후회할 수 있으니 보실 분은 훑어 보시길 바라며.. return 은 어떤 일을 할까? 1. 값을 반환 (배출한다, 꺼내준다로 해석) (- 코딩 초보자로서 return을 검색하면 다 값을 반환한다는 표현을 사용하는데 항상 좀 더 풀어서 설명해줬으면 했었다..) var test = function (){ var x = 1; } test(); 이런식의 코드를 짰을 때 과연 무슨 일이 일어날까? 결론 :: 아무 일도 일어나지 않는다. 현재의 코드는 "x=1 인 자판기가 있기만 한 상태" 이다. (지역변수를 담은.. var, let, const 차이점 정리(링크) https://gist.github.com/LeoHeo/7c2a2a6dbcf80becaaa1e61e90091e5d javascript var, let, const 차이점 javascript var, let, const 차이점. GitHub Gist: instantly share code, notes, and snippets. gist.github.com var (function scope) - 전역에서 선언하면 전역에서 인식됨 - function name(){ 이 안에서 선언한 것은 이 안에서만 인식됨 } - $(function(){ 이 안에서 인식된 것도 이 안에서만 인식되어야 하는데 }) 전역에서도 인식되는 경우가 있음 var 로 선언하는 변수는 function 안에서 선언한 변수가 전역에서도 작동하.. 선택한 색상으로 색 변하게 만드는 법(onclick, for, switch) 안녕하세요! 이번에 다루는 기능은 제가 예전에 만들었었는데 안타깝게도 적용되지 않은 기능이랍니다...ㅠㅠ 비록 쓰이지는 않았지만 블로그에 게시해서 공유해보고 싶었어요! ㅎㅎ 선택한 색상에 따라 대표 색상이 바뀌도록 만들었는데요! 여기서 사용한 대표적인 기능은! onclick="" html에서 태그에 적용하는 함수입니다. for(){} 증가문을 설정해줍니다 switch(){} 상황을 하나씩 설정해줍니다. (case1, case2....) 입니다 [1] 각 html 에 onclick(num, this) 를 먼저 설정해주고 [2] for 를 사용해 증가문을 설정해주고 (색상의 개수 이하로 증가되도록 설정) [3] 증가문의 수와 html의 onclick에 설정된 num이 같으면 [4] 각 넘버에 해당하는 색상이.. [scrollTop] 스크롤을 내리면 숨겨져있던 객체 등장! 스크롤 시, 숨겨진 객체가 등장하는 기능! 스크롤만 하면 뿅 등장하는게 재밌죠 (문과 감수성) 기능 소개에 앞서 살짝 헷갈릴 수 있으니 설명을 좀 달게요 스크롤 시 객체가 등장하는 기능은 일정 높이를 지났을 때, 숨겨진 객체를 등장시키는 개념이에요 그래서 처음 *^^* 가 적힌 객체의 높이를 먼저 구한 후, 윈도우 스크롤이 그 높이를 지났을 때 숨겨진 객체가 등장하는 거랍니다. 대표적으로 사용하는 기능입니다! $(객체).height(); 객체의 높이를 재줍니다. $(window).scroll(function(){}); 윈도우 스크롤 시 발생되는 기능 문법입니다. $(this).scrollTop(); 윈도우 스크롤 상단 수치라고 생각하시면 됩니다. (스크롤이 시작되는 지점은 0부터 시작합니다.) 작동원리 .. 클릭할 때마다 객체 추가하는 법(append, prepend) 버튼을 누를 때 마다 박스가 추가되는 기능! 뿅뿅뿅 하고 나타나는 박스들 좀 보세요~ 꺄올 여기에 쓰이는 대표기능은?? $(박스들이 추가되는 공간"부모").append(박스, HTML 형식으로 작성합니다.); 자매품 prepend 도 있습니다. (같은 형식으로 사용) (부모요소).append(추가할 자식요소); append, prepend 로 요소를 추가하는 기능은 부모요소에 적용하여 자녀를 늘리는 방식! append는 기존객체 뒤로 생성, prepend는 기존객체 앞에 생성 끝 감사합니다 이전 1 2 3 4 5 6 다음